Agglomeration through extrusion and spheronization is one of the oldest techniques for manufacturing pellets. The process consists of four process steps: Moistening the powder mixture, forming cylinder-shaped agglomerate through extrusion, breaking and rounding the extrudate to round pellets through spheronization, and drying the finished product.
Pelletizing differs from other agglomeration techniques in that the powdered ore is first formed into a "green" pellet or ball, which is then dried and hardened in a separate step, usually by heating. Green pellets are made by combining moist ore with a binder and rolling it into balls using either a pelletizing disk or a pelletizing drum.
